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Herne Hill (Station) to Waterloo Station?

The cheapest way to get from Herne Hill (Station) to Waterloo Station is to train and subway which costs $4.13 - $9.78 and takes 12 min.

What is the fastest way to get from Herne Hill (Station) to Waterloo Station?

The fastest way to get from Herne Hill (Station) to Waterloo Station is to taxi which takes 11 min and costs $25 - $30.43 .

Is there a direct bus between Herne Hill (Station) and Waterloo Station?

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Herne Hill Station station and arriving at Waterloo Station / Tenison Way station.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 36 min.

Is there a direct train between Herne Hill (Station) and Waterloo Station?

No, there is no direct train from Herne Hill (Station) to Waterloo Station. However, there are services departing from Herne Hill and arriving at London Waterloo via Elephant & Castle station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 12 min.

How far is it from Herne Hill (Station) to Waterloo Station?

The distance between Herne Hill (Station) and Waterloo Station is 6 km.

How do I travel from Herne Hill (Station) to Waterloo Station without a car?

The best way to get from Herne Hill (Station) to Waterloo Station without a car is to train and subway which takes 12 min and costs $4.13 - $9.78 .

How long does it take to get from Herne Hill (Station) to Waterloo Station?

It takes approximately 12 min to get from Herne Hill (Station) to Waterloo Station, including transfers.
